What month is the first month?
According to the calendar, the last day of the first month in 2023 is February 18 of the Gregorian calendar, which is the 29th day of the first lunar month. The first month is the month of "building rights". In the era of observing images and observing times, bucket handle belonged to Yin, and the month was the first month.
January of the lunar calendar, also known as the first month and the end of the month, is the beginning of a year. The first month is the first month of the lunar calendar in China. The 10th day of the first month or the middle of the first month, most of the time happens to be the beginning of the Spring Festival, and beginning of spring is in the late twelfth lunar month. The first month is the slack season in the north, and it is also the month to celebrate the arrival of the New Year. Traditionally, we usually refer to the first day of the first month to the fifteenth day of the first month as New Year's Day.
